This proceedings book is based on selected and reviewed contributions from the AUTEX 2025 World Conference, held on June 11-13, 2025, in Dresden, and specifically focuses on sustainability, chemistry, and finishing in the textile sector. It highlights innovative research on eco-friendly processes, advanced material development, and circular economy strategies. Topics include conductive textiles using carbon nanotube coatings, bio-based dyeing with wood extracts, UV modification of hemp fibers, and sustainable tanning methods. The volume also addresses ultrasonic washing for improved fastness, thermodynamic analysis of dyeing, environmentally responsible surface treatments, and polymer-based photonic textiles. Further sections explore bio-based coatings with nano-SiO2, hybrid polymer matrices, and recycling approaches such as enzymatic degradation and elastane removal. By integrating sustainability intelligence, digital product passports, and energy-efficient finishing technologies, this book provides a comprehensive roadmap for advancing traceability, circularity, and environmental responsibility in textiles.
